For this video, I wanted to go a little more in-depth about my finishing technique. I use General Finishes Arm-R-Seal in Satin and apply it with a foam brush. There are a few tips and tricks I have picked up to help get a smooth beautiful finish.
This coffee table was a commission project and I am very happy with how it came out! The walnut has its flaws, but the cocobolo bowties and epoxy made it into a beautiful piece of furniture. I had a problem with the epoxy pooling in the tape at the bottom which means I wasted a few ounces. Next time I'll use some foil tape to hold the seal better and prevent this waste.
